Industrial robotics and health-related imaging programs operate in options the place durability and environmental resilience are non-negotiable. These devices often experience corrosive agents, temperature fluctuations, dampness ingress, vibration, and shock—all factors that could jeopardize overall performance or induce premature element failure. Sourcing connectors from the respected round connector maker specializing in mil-dtl-38999 expectations makes sure parts are crafted from elements like aluminum alloy shells dealt with with cadmium and tin plating for outstanding corrosion resistance. The connectors also employ PTFE-based dielectric insulators and gold-plated beryllium copper contacts, safeguarding electrical continuity beneath Intense circumstances. A navy connector company that adheres strictly to MIL-STD-202 assessments confirms that vibration, salt spray, water publicity, and thermal cycling endure demanding trials. This center on environmental resilience helps keep information signal top quality and electrical electrical power shipping, which happen to be crucial in seamless robotics Command and large-resolution imaging diagnostics. responsible interfacing methods decrease system interruptions, lengthen tools lifespans, and copyright patient security or production precision. Benefits of vibration and shock resistance inherent to the MS27496E21B35PN design

Vibration and shock are continuous challenges in industrial automation and clinical technological know-how, wherever even slight connector failure can cascade into major downtime or diagnostic inaccuracies. The MS27496E21B35PN product inside the MIL-DTL-38999 sequence exemplifies how manufacturers handle these requires. Crafted by a skilled round connector maker, this precise model undergoes compliance with MIL-STD-202 vibration and shock testing, guaranteeing operational security in environments characterised by mechanical disturbances. Its robust aluminum alloy housing and hermetic sealing reduce ingress of contaminants, whilst the hybrid Speak to system minimizes sign cross-chat that might interfere with delicate measurements or communications. army connector brands have optimized this connector to endure a minimum of 500 mating cycles without the need of degradation, making certain longevity in dynamic programs. This dependability plays a essential function in robotics the place steady motion and sudden effect are prevalent, and also in clinical imaging programs exactly where precise, interference-absolutely free information transmission is essential for precise success. effect of connector structure on system uptime and servicing simplification

Connector style extends considerably past mechanical robustness; it profoundly influences operational uptime and upkeep simplicity in complicated methods. The MS27496E21B35PN and other MIL-DTL-38999 connectors, created by expert navy connector suppliers, combine user-centric attributes that streamline process upkeep in industrial robotics and professional medical imaging contexts. Resource-considerably less visual keying inspection allows quick verification of connector alignment, reducing human error during assembly and field repairs. Laser-etched serial figures present traceability and top quality Command for provider teams, simplifying fault diagnosis and stock administration. The connector’s compatibility with EMI filter backshells addresses electromagnetic interference problems, boosting sign security essential to robotic sensory comments loops and diagnostic imaging clarity. This considerate style minimizes the necessity for frequent downtime, allowing for engineers to carry out routine maintenance with self-assurance and velocity.
